Internship Description
Intern Title: Marketing & Communications Intern
Classification: Part‐time, Unpaid
Reports to: Marketing and PR Coordinator
Start/End Dates: Spring 2010 Semester, Specific Dates/Times Flexible
Position Overview:
The Marketing and Communications Intern will provide support to Young Audiences’ Marketing and PR Coordinator and the Development and Marketing Department as a whole. Intern will perform a wide range of marketing and communications tasks that will help him/her gain experience in the field while gaining a better understanding of the nonprofit world.
Specific Responsibilities:
• Assists in drafting written materials, including marketing collateral, press releases, Web site
content and e‐mail blast content
• Assists in the creation and distribution of newsletters, e‐newsletters, the 2010‐2011 program
guide and other promotional materials
• Helps plan and coordinate logistics for special events and publicizes those events externally
• Represents Young Audiences at community events alongside staff and volunteers
• Manages organization’s mailing lists and media lists
• Supports the Spring Appeal campaign
• Coordinates internal staff communications as directed
• Other duties as needed
Qualifications:
• Applicant must be enrolled as a full‐time undergraduate student at a local university or college
• Pursuing a degree in English, Journalism, Marketing, Public Relations, Communications or
related field preferred
• Must be pursuing this internship for credit through college or university
• Excellent written and oral communication skills
• Attention to detail and great interpersonal/organizational skills
• Ability to meet deadlines and work cooperatively with other YA staff and volunteers
• Positive and enthusiastic attitude
• Some standing, walking, bending, frequent use of hands, stooping and light lifting (up to 10
pounds) is needed occasionally.
